WPBeginner WordPress tutorials help you learn WordPress, so you can improve your website. Our step by step WordPress tutorials are easy to understand and will help you follow the WordPress best practices. Don't waste your time buying WordPress books or outdated WordPress tutorial PDFs that cover just the basics. Our WordPress tutorials are written by experts with 15+ years of WordPress experience, and it contains real-life examples and tips that allows you to learn WordPress faster. We also keep our tutorials up to date.
You can find our other latest free WordPress tutorials below, and you can always use the search feature on our site to find helpful WordPress tutorials faster.
If you don't see a WordPress tutorial that you're looking for, then please reach out to your team and let us know. All our WordPress tutorial ideas are suggested by our users over the last 13+ years.
Nothing kills productivity quite like a WordPress dashboard that takes forever to load. You’re trying to quickly publish a blog post or update a page, but instead you’re stuck watching that spinning wheel while your 5-minute task turns into a 20-minute nightmare. We’ve been there… Read More »
Are you collecting form submissions on your WordPress site but never showing them to your visitors? That’s a missed opportunity. Showing entries like reviews, member lists, or event calendars on your site gives them a purpose. They can help visitors find information, see real feedback,… Read More »
WordPress themes that support full site editing (FSE) don’t include a theme customizer option in the admin panel. Instead, you will see a new ‘Editor’ option under the Appearance menu. This can be frustrating if you are used to using the tool to make adjustments… Read More »
A well-designed navigation menu is important if you want to create a positive user experience on your WordPress site. While horizontal menus are common, a vertical navigation menu offers a unique and effective way to organize your site’s content, especially for websites with a lot… Read More »
If you’re looking to create a gym website that attracts new members and helps manage your existing ones, you’re in the right place. Over the years, our team has refined the process of building membership sites that convert visitors into paying customers. We’ve also tested… Read More »
RSS makes it easy to automatically pull content from other sites and display it on yours. It is a great way to keep your readers engaged with fresh, relevant information. By displaying RSS feeds, you can automatically feature news, updates, or articles from other sources,… Read More »
Want to add text to your WordPress images? Those attractive titles and quotes you see layered over photos can really make your content stand out. It’s called a text overlay, and it’s a great way to make your images more engaging. If you’ve been wondering… Read More »
Whether you’re organizing an event, running a contest, or collecting survey responses, managing form entries in WordPress is super important. Sometimes, you may need to limit the number of entries to prevent overwhelming your system or to meet specific guidelines. For instance, you might have… Read More »
Would you prefer to eat at an empty restaurant or one that is buzzing with happy customers? Most people would choose the busy one, and the same principle applies to your website. That’s why, at WPBeginner, we display our readership statistics as social proof. This… Read More »
Custom post types are essential for organizing and displaying diverse content like portfolios, testimonials, and products. However, by default, WordPress search results may not include custom post types, potentially leaving valuable content undiscovered. At WPBeginner, we know how important it is to make your entire… Read More »
Used to store interaction and conversion data for campaigns in conjunction with Revenue Attribution.
1 year
_gat_omTracker*
Set, controlled and used by Google Analytics to collect and store data and then send that data to Google Analytics. OptinMonster provides the name if there is no existing tracker found on that page.
-
omCountdown-{id}-{elementId}
Used for countdown elements {elementId} in campaigns {id} to determine when it should complete.
-
om-{id}-closed / omSlideClosed-{id}
Used specifically with slide-in campaigns {id} to determine if it has been closed or not by a visitor.
30 days
om-success-cookie / omSuccessCookie
Used to determine if a visitor has successfully opted in to any campaign on your site to unlock content when using our Content Locking feature.
365 days
om-success-{id} / omSuccess-{id}
Used to determine if a visitor has successfully opted in to a campaign with the ID of {id} on your site.
365 days
omSeen-{id}
Used to determine if a visitor has been shown a campaign by the slug.
30 days
om-{id}
Used to determine if a visitor has interacted with a campaign ID of {id} on your site.
30 days
_omappvs
Used to determine when a new visitor becomes a returning visitor.